Company Overview
Eurocept Pharmaceuticals, founded in 2001, has rapidly evolved into a significant player in the specialty pharma and medical homecare sectors. Based in the Netherlands, the company has expanded its reach across Europe and beyond, focusing on specialized medicines and innovative healthcare solutions.
Historical Growth
Since its inception, Eurocept has demonstrated impressive growth:
- In 2012, the company reported a turnover of €147 million[1].
- By 2013, Eurocept had established itself as a leading player in the Dutch market for specialty pharma and medical home care[1].
- The company's growth trajectory continued, leading to strategic investments and expansions in subsequent years.
Market Position
Eurocept Pharmaceuticals has strategically positioned itself at the intersection of specialty pharmaceuticals and medical homecare services, creating a unique value proposition in the healthcare market.
Specialty Pharmaceuticals
In the specialty pharma sector, Eurocept focuses on:
- Registration, marketing, and distribution of specialized medicines
- Key therapeutic areas including anesthetics, psychiatry, urology, pediatrics, and infectious diseases[1]
Medical Homecare Services
Eurocept's homecare division provides:
- Specialist medical homecare treatments
- Infusion therapies at patients' homes
- A comprehensive 'Hospital-at-home' offering[3]
This dual focus allows Eurocept to offer an integrated approach to patient care, differentiating it from competitors who may specialize in only one of these areas.

4. Focus on Rare Diseases
In recent years, Eurocept has sharpened its focus on rare diseases:
- Developing a platform infrastructure for specialty pharma products
- Expanding its geographic footprint to become a global player in rare diseases
- Successfully filing its first product in the USA in 2022[3]
This focus on rare diseases positions Eurocept in a high-growth, high-value segment of the pharmaceutical market.

3. Emphasis on Hospital-to-Home Care Transition
Recognizing the global trend towards outpatient care, Eurocept has:
- Developed a comprehensive 'Hospital-at-home' offering
- Expanded services to include nutrition, home/kidney dialysis, and complex wound care[3]
- Positioned itself as a frontrunner in innovative home care solutions in Europe
